Product Description:
It’s official: There is no longer a stigma associated with Internet dating. It’s true. We promise. Nearly 50 million Americans have tried it. That means roughly half of the single adult population has filled out an online dating profile or has at least browsed a few personal ads, just to see who’s out there. Quickly disappearing are the days of awkward setups and random encounters. Today’s singles simply post a profile on a handful of dating websites, then sit back and wait for the dates to roll in. Well, that’s the idea anyway. The reality is that most people slap together vague and uninspired dating profiles and quickly become disillusioned when 'the one' doesn’t respond the next day. In I CAN’T BELIEVE I’M BUYING THIS BOOK, Internet dating expert Evan Marc Katz—a former MatchNet consultant and avowed online dater—demystifies the world of Internet dating. He offers practical advice on choosing the right dating website, writing eye-catching profiles, striking up that first email 'conversation,' turning a first date into a second, and much more. Equal parts how-to guide and inspirational pep talk, I CAN’T BELIEVE I’M BUYING THIS BOOK is like having a chat with a good friend, in this case, a hysterically funny, insightful friend who tells it like it is while remaining cheerfully optimistic about the universal quest for love. Whether you’re an online dating junkie or a complete newcomer, an enthusiastic twentysomething or a been-there-done-that divorcée, this irreverent and intelligent guide will teach even the most jaded single how to master the dating game and find true love online.

Rating: 4 out of 5 stars - Guidance for Newbies
Katz is a consultant for online daters, so this book is a come-on that probably gets him additional consulting business. This is a short, readable guide for people new to online dating. It is particularly good in comparing the features of the leading online dating services and in consistently advocating for honesty in what you say in profiles. Less helpful is a chapter of five profiles he has helped write which is supposed to show you how to do a better profile but actually ends up encouraging you to seek Katz's consulting help. The book has much helpful information, but for a better introduction to online dating for beginners I would recommend Online Dating for Dummies.
